Sebastopol Creek
Sebastopol Creek is a stream in Marlborough, South Island. Sebastopol Creek is situated nearby to the locality Mendip Hills, as well as near the hamlet Ferniehurst.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Hundalee
Locality
Hundalee is a rural locality in the Hurunui District of the Canterbury region of New Zealand's South Island. It straddles the Conway River, the traditional boundary between Canterbury and Marlborough and is in the Hundalee Hills. Hundalee is situated 8 km southeast of Sebastopol Creek.
